  • 재구성형 프로세서는 파워를 적게 사용하면서도 높은 성능을 낼 수 있는 프로세서이다. 재구성형 프로세서는 하드웨어에 최대한 많은 계산 자원을 넣으면서도 구조를 최대한 간단하게 하여 저전력 소모와 고성능을 동시에 추구하였다. 하지만 구조를 최대한 간단히 하는 과정에서 프로그램의 수행을 관리하는 많은 하드웨어 로직이 빠지게 되었는데, 이 부분은 컴파일러에서 코드를 생성할 때 스케쥴링과 수행 순서까지 정해지도록 소프트웨어적 관점에서 처리하기로 하였다. 이를 사용하기 위해 컴파일러는 입력된 프로그램을 분석하고 재구성형 프로세서에서 수행될 수 있는 형태로 코드를 각 계산자원에 매핑하는 작업을 수행해 주어야 한다. 재구성형 프로세서의 레지스터는 이 매핑 과정에서 데이터의 전달을 위해서 주로 사용되게 된다. 이 논문에서는 다양한 멀티미디어 응용 프로그램을 사용하여 멀티미디어 환경에서 재구성형 프로세서가 사용될 때 레지스터 개수가 성능에 미치는 영향을 제시한다.

  • The fabrication of ceramic machine components by injection molding(CIM : Ceramic Injection Molding) is critically dependent on the shaping and binder extraction techniques. Injection molding is of keen interest to ceramic industries because CIM is suitable for making an intricate shape and manufacturing cost is lower than other process when production scale is large. The success of the molding process is dependent on the correct formulation of the organic vehicle and the achievement of optimum filler loading. Fine alumina powders and polyethylene binder systems were employed to prepare moldable blend then produce a simple specimen by compression molding. Flow characteristics of the mixture was evaluated by viscosity measurement. Optimum binder system and ceramic volume loading for injection molding were determind. A good debinding technique was utilized to improve the quality of debinded parts and save the debinding time. The simple ceramic part was successfully sintered after debinding and its microstructure examined with SEM revealed good consolidation.

  • Micro-tow deformation during forming of PVC foam-fabric composite sandwich structure is investigated to find out the correlation between forming condition and material deformation. The foams used in this research are PVC foams which have 4 different densities and the fabric composite is Carbon/epoxy prepreg which is plain weave (3k) as a skin material. Tow parameters such as crimp angle and tow amplitude are measured using microscope and a proper image tool and are compared with each other. In order to find out the effect of foam deformation during forming on tow deformation the compressive tests of foams are performed in three different environmental temperatures ($25^{\circ}C$, $80{\circ}C$, $125^{\circ}C$). The microscopic observation results show that the micro tow deformations are quite different from each other with respect to the foam density and forming pressure.

  • The purpose of this study was to evaluate the canal configuration after shaping by ProFile. ProTaper and K-Flexofile in simulated resin canals with different angles of curvature. Three types of instruments were used: ProFile. ProTaper. K-Flexofile. Simulated root canals. which were made of epoxy resin. were prepared by ProFile. ProTaper with rotary instrument using a crown-down pressureless technique. and hand instrumentation was performed by K-Flexofile using a step-back technique. All simulated. canals were prepared up to size 25 file at end-point of preparation. Pre and post instrumentation images were recorded with Scanner. Assessment of canal shape was completed with Image Analysis program. Measurements were made at 1. 2. 3. 4. 5. 6. 7. 8. 9 and 10mm from the apex. At each level. outer canal width. inner canal width. total canal width. and amount of transportation from original axis were recorded. Instrument deformation and fracture were recorded. Data were analyzed by means of one-way ANOVA analysis of variance and the Sheffe's test. The result was that ProFile and ProTaper maintain original canal shape regardless of the increase of angle of curvature than K-Flexofile. ProFile show significantly less canal transportation and maintained original canal shape better than ProTaper.

  • In order to optimize the prepreg compression molding (PCM) process, the forming simulation is required to cope with any problems that may be raised during the process. For the improvement of simulation accuracy, the input data of material property should be measured accurately. However, most studies assume that the compressive properties of the prepreg are identical to the tensile properties without quantifying them separately. Therefore, in this study, the in - plane compressive properties of the prepreg are presented to improve the accuracy of the forming simulation. As a result, the compressive modulus of the fibers was measured to be about $10^{-2}$ times lower than the tensile modulus. Also we designed a square-cup mold with a tilting angle of $110^{\circ}$ to simulate the prepreg formability during the high temperature compression mold process. Shear angles were measured at each corner, which were compared with the simulation results. It was observed that the simulation results using the accurate compressive properties of the prepreg showed a similar trend with the experimental results. It was confirmed that the measured data of the in-plane compression property improved the accuracy of the forming simulation results.

  • This paper describes the finite element analysis and die design change of cold heading punching process to increase the cold forging tool life and reduce the tool wear and stress concentration. Through this study, the optimization of punch tool design has been studied by an analysis of tool stress and wear distribution to improve the tool life. Plastic deformation analysis was carried out in order to understand the cold heading process between tool and workpiece stress distribution. Cold heading punch die design was set up to each process with different four types analysis progressing, the cold heading punch dies shapes with combination of point angle and punch edge corner radius shapes of cold forging dies, punch die material properties and frictional coefficient. The design parameters of point angle and corner radius of punch die geometry, die material properties and frictional coefficient were selected to apply optimization with the DoE (design of experiment) and Taguchi method. DoE and Taguchi method was performed to optimize the cold heading punch die design parameters optimization for bolt head cold forging process, it was possible to expect an reduce the cold heading punch die wear to the 37 % compared with current using cold heading punch in the shop floor.

  • This paper presents the parallel distributed control scheme for shaping of the bent glass. The designed system consists of a PC, a main controller and 11 servo-controllers, the precision motion controllers. Each elements are connected by using RS-232C and 8-bit data bus. In order to guarantee the stability and the control performance, we use a precision PID motion controller and a H-bridge on the servo-drivers. PC calculates position values of 11 DC motors by using the pre-determined curvature value and offers the user interface environment operator. The main controller provides the control instructions and parameter values to 11 servo-controllers by chip enable signal, simultaneously. Using the received commands and parameter values, the servo-controllers control the positions of the DC motors based on PID control scheme.

  • Autoclave process has been remaining as one of the most robust and stable process in fabricating structural composite part of aerospace industry. It has lots of advantages, however exhibits some disadvantages or limitations in capital investment and operation. Recently, there have been various Out-of-Autoclave process being researched and developed to overcome those limitations. In this study, laminate specimens were fabricated using LCM (Liquid Composite Molding) process, regarded as one of potential OoA process. DB (Double bagging), CAPRI (Controlled Atmospheric Pressure Resin Infusion), VAP (Vacuum Assisted Process) and Autoclave process were used for laminate specimens. Void content, Thickness, Tg (Glass Transition Temperature), ILSS (Interlaminar Shear Strength) and Flexural strength properties were evaluated for comparison. It is verified that Autoclave based specimen has uniform thickness distribution, the lowest void content and outstanding mechanical properties. And, CAPRI based specimen exhibits relatively good physical and mechanical properties over DB and VAP based specimen and comparable mechanical properties with autoclave based specimen.

  • Purpose: Metacarpal fractures are common injuries of the hand. They are treated using closed reduction (CR) or open reduction (OR) techniques. The management strategy depends on fracture site characteristic and fixation methods. In this study, we evaluated pre- and postoperative fracture angulation, when metacarpal fractures bad been treated using two different techniques: CR with parallel transverse pinning and OR with plate fixation. Methods: Forty-six patients undergoing anatomic reduction to treat extra-articular metacarpal fractures were recruited. They were included in one of two therapeutic groups: Group 1, CR with parallel transverse pinning (n=21); Group 2, OR with plate fixation (n=25). Fracture angulation values have been measured on pre- and postoperative radiologic images. Values were compared between pre- and postoperative states, and between corresponding measurements of each group. Results: All extra-articular metacarpal fractures were successfully treated without wound related complications or the limit of joint motion. Both groups demonstrated adequate reduction at immediate postoperative period (postoperative angulation of group 1, $20^{\circ}{\pm}7^{\circ}$; group 2, $19^{\circ}{\pm}5^{\circ}$). During the observation at follow-up period, Group 1 exhibited slight recurrence (follow-up angulation of group 1, $24^{\circ}{\pm}10^{\circ}$). Nonetheless, Group 2 showed adequate reduction state in both immediate postoperative and long-term follow-up periods (follow-up angulation of group 2, $18^{\circ}{\pm}6^{\circ}$). Conclusion: Extra-articular metacarpal fractures were successfully restored without functional complications. CR with parallel transverse pinning method exhibited recurrence after pin removal, which necessitates cautious postoperative exercise and monitoring.
